The MÜSİAD Agriculture, Food and Livestock Sector Board addressed the present and future of the sector with university youth
The “Sectoral Sharing with Young People” program, at which young people came together at İstanbul Sabahattin Zaim University, was successfully held. The program was organized with the aim of raising university students' awareness of the agriculture, food and livestock sectors and enabling them to establish direct contact with the business world.
The program began with the opening and greeting speech of İstanbul Sabahattin Zaim University Vice Rector Prof. Dr. İsmail Küçük.
Taking the floor within the scope of the program, MÜSİAD Agriculture, Food and Livestock Sector Board Chairman Mr. Emrullah Gökhan explained the activities of MÜSİAD and of the Agriculture, Food and Livestock Sector Board. Stating that production capacity is decreasing in Türkiye because of the rising average age of farmers, Gökhan emphasized that innovative and technological work should be increased and the number of young farmers multiplied.
Stating that young people should not give up in the face of any adversity, he drew attention to the importance of knowing a foreign language and following innovations abroad. He also touched upon the role of apprenticeship and experience in professional development.
In the continuation of the program, SFG Chairman of the Board Mr. Muharrem Kaan shared his experiences in business life with the participants. He emphasized the importance of gaining experience and of collective work in working life.
Afterwards, Danet Chairman of the Board Mr. Sait Uluçay shared his assessments regarding the current situation of the livestock sector in Türkiye. Drawing attention to the importance of planning in the sector, Uluçay expressed the necessity of going out into the field in working life.
The last speaker of the program, MÜSİAD Sector Boards Commission Chairman Mr. Cemal Özen, gave information about the work being carried out. Stating that process management and acting together bring success in business life, Özen drew attention to the importance of being trustworthy and of working with morality and conscience. Expressing that joint work should be undertaken to increase agricultural production, he advised young people to be patient.
The program ended with the presentation of a plaque.
